Q. What is herbal tea?
Herbal tea, also known as tisane, is a hot beverage made by steeping dried herbs, flowers, fruits, and spices in hot water. Unlike traditional tea made from Camellia sinensis leaves, herbal tea does not contain caffeine.

Q. What are the benefits of drinking herbal tea?
Herbal tea has a range of potential health benefits, depending on the specific herbs used. Some common benefits include promoting relaxation and stress relief, boosting the immune system, aiding digestion, and supporting overall health and wellness.

Q. What types of herbs are used in herbal tea?
Herbal tea can be made from a wide range of herbs and botanicals, including lemon ginger tea, moringa herbal tea, ginseng herbal tea and many others. Each herb has unique properties and potential health benefits.

Q. How do I make herbal tea?
Herbal tea is typically made by steeping 1-2 teaspoons of dried herbs or a tea bag in 8 ounces of hot water for 5-10 minutes. The exact steeping time and water temperature may vary depending on the specific herbs used. We recommend following the instructions on the tea packaging or consulting a recipe for specific guidance.

Q. Is herbal tea safe for everyone to drink?
While herbal tea is generally considered safe for most people, some herbs may interact with medications or have potential side effects. It's important to research the herbs used in a specific tea and consult with a healthcare professional if you have any concerns.

Q. Is herbal tea vegan and gluten-free?
Herbal tea is typically vegan and gluten-free, as it does not contain any animal products or gluten-containing ingredients. However, it's always important to check the ingredient list to be sure.

Q. What is the best time to drink herbal tea?
The best time to drink herbal tea may vary depending on the specific herbs used and their intended effects. Some herbs are best consumed in the morning to help boost energy, while others are more relaxing and may be better consumed in the evening before bed. We recommend researching the specific herbs used in a tea and their properties to determine the best time to consume.

Q. How long can I store herbal tea?
The shelf life of herbal tea can vary depending on the specific herbs used and how the tea is stored. In general, most herbal teas are best consumed within 6-12 months of purchase. To extend the shelf life, we recommend storing the tea in an airtight container in a cool, dry place.

Q. Can I sweeten herbal tea?
Yes, herbal tea can be sweetened with honey, maple syrup, or another sweetener of your choice. Some herbal teas may also benefit from a squeeze of lemon or other citrus juice to enhance their flavor.

Q. Does herbal tea have any caffeine?
No, herbal tea does not contain caffeine. However, some herbal tea blends may include ingredients like black tea or green tea, which do contain caffeine. It's important to check the ingredients list to determine whether a specific tea blend contains caffeine.
